As a result of innovative new technologies, transport infrastructure has seen substantial enhancements over the years. Innovation has been integrated into key components of infrastructure. Roadways, bridges and many public transport systems are now using smart tools and traffic management systems, integrating sensors and cameras to keep track of traffic and enhance safety. Similarly, traffic lights can change based upon real-time traffic data, which has worked for reducing hold-ups and fuel consumption. Technology also helps to inspect the conditions of roads and bridges, so repair work can be made as soon as possible. As cities continue to grow, innovation is ending up being more important for sustaining the day-to-day travel needs of the population. Digital innovation has considerably changed the way that people use and operate transportation. Many individuals currently use mobile apps to plan journeys, check traffic and even pay for public transportation. These apps typically combine different travel options, like buses and trains into one all-inclusive system. In addition to supporting commuters, in the logistics sector and great transport, digital softwares have been functional in helping to track packages, plan better paths and decrease delays in transit. Transportation technology companies and authorities are also equipped to use digital data to get a better understanding of how people travel and make better decisions when it pertains to services and planning. It has played a significant role in improving the transport industry, particularly reworking vehicles to be more efficient. One of the . most considerable technology transportation examples is the advancement of electric powered and hybrid engines, which are helping to decrease pollution and make transportation more eco-friendly. For example, the development of self-driving cars and autonomous vehicles have been revolutionary in both the transportation and technology segments and have been extremely prominent in the improvement of transport planning and technology in urban areas. Accordingly, many new vehicles have sophisticated incorporated security features, such as automated braking, parking guidance and sensors that help motorists stay safe. Not only are these technologies enhancing the driving experience, but they are also supporting a shift in the direction of a more sustainable and smart transport system. Together, these modifications are making automobiles more efficient, safer and much better for the natural environment.
